Synopsis of Enseñanzas del Papa sobre los mayores
Este libro, 'Enseñanzas del Papa sobre los mayores', es una reflexión sobre la vida religiosa y cristiana, con un enfoque especial en los ancianos. Publicado por PPC en 1999, forma parte de la colección 'Documentos' y ha sido preparado por Vida Ascendente. El autor, Juan Pablo II, ofrece una perspectiva valiosa sobre el papel de los mayores en la sociedad y la Iglesia Católica.

John Paul II
Pope John Paul II was head of the Catholic Church and sovereign of Vatican City from 16 October 1978 until his death in 2005. He was the first non-Italian pope since Adrian VI in the 16th century, as well as the third-longest-serving pope in history, after St. Peter and Pius IX.
